The pros and cons of online debt consolidation
Ok, let's deal with the pros first. Here are the positive aspects of an online debt consolidation company:


  Free quotes. Most debt management companies will review the information that you provide on their initial questionnaire and send free quotes specifically for a debt consolidation loan and/or program tailored to your situation.

  Reduced rates. Nothing is guaranteed, but if a debt consolidation company can find an APR half as low as the one you are currently paying, which many companies advertise, then you will be on your way to hundreds in savings per month. Continuing to pay high interest on your debt is a surefire way to never escape from debt.


Online debt consolidation and pros and cons
There is really only one main con, or negative trait, of an online debt consolidation service, but it's a major one: 

False promises. It's easy to get lured in by the guarantee of complete debt elimination within five years, but while this is plausible, it's far from assured. The companies that continually promise this achievement may not be able to deliver it. If you find a fraudulent, or sub-par, online debt consolidation company, then you may end up paying extra money, when you are already in debt, for a service that does not accomplish anything significant.
